LiFePO4 vs. Ternary Li: Best Battery Choice?

Here, the names of the two batteries actually refer to the positive electrode materials of their battery cells. Lithium iron phosphate batteries naturally use lithium iron phosphate (LiFePO4), while the ternary materials in ternary lithium batteries refer to the combination of nickel (Ni), cobalt (Co), manganese (Mn), or aluminum (Al) (commonly ...

LiFePO4 Batteries vs Ternary Lithium Batteries (NCM, NCA)

Lithium Iron Phosphate (LiFePO4) Battery: Lithium Iron Phosphate (LiFePO4) Battery is a type of lithium-ion battery that uses lithium iron phosphate as the positive electrode material and carbon as the negative electrode material. The individual cell has a rated voltage of 3.2V, with a charging cutoff voltage between 3.6V and 3.65V.".

Lithium Iron Phosphate vs. Lithium-Ion: Differences and Pros

There are significant differences in energy when comparing lithium-ion and lithium iron phosphate. Lithium-ion has a higher energy density at 150/200 Wh/kg versus lithium iron phosphate at 90/120 Wh/kg. So, lithium-ion is normally the go-to source for power hungry electronics that drain batteries at a high rate.

A LiFePO4 battery vs lithium ion polymer battery

A LiFePO4 battery vs lithium ion polymer battery. The cycle life of a Lithium iron phosphate (LiFePO4) battery is more than 4 to 5 times that of other lithium ion polymer batteries. The operating temperature range is wider and safer; however, the discharge platform is lower, the nominal voltage is only 3.2V, and the fully-charged voltage is 3.65V.
